Get startedTyne House is a four-bedroom end-of-terrace house in Wylam (NE41 8DT). It has a recorded floor area of 192 m² (around 2067 sq ft), construction records dating it to 1900-1929 and council tax band D. The latest certificate (June 2025) shows a D (score 56), a step below the typical UK home. The rating has held steady at D across 2 certificates since June 2014. Between certificates, lighting went from Average to Very Good; while roof efficiency dropped from Average to Very Poor. The recommended improvements would push it to C (score 76).
Sale prices here have outpaced England HPI: 6.9% per year against 0% for the wider region. Today's modelled estimate of £479,000 sits 71.1% above the 2014 sale of £279,950. At 192 m² the property is well over the postcode median (74 m² across 5 EPCs), placing it in the larger end of the local stock. One planning record on file: a loft conversion approved in 2022. Past consents include a loft conversion, meaningful when judging how the property has evolved. Last sold in August 2014, so it's been off the market for around 12 years.
Tyne House's carbon output runs well above what efficient homes in the postcode produce.
